Englischer Garden Park & Eisbach Surfing Wave

Munich’s most famous park gets its glory for good reason. Sprawling fields, a babbling creek, wildflowers & a giant Chinese Pagoda/Biergarten–what’s not to love? The locals certainly do as it was packed on a Thursday. Who doesn’t love a beer in the sun?
And you can’t not stop by to admire the athletic talents of the surfers at the Eisbach. Yes, surfers in the middle of a park, in the middle of a city, in the middle of a landlocked country in Europe. The Eisbach is a man-made surfing wave from a fast flowing river. The wave is narrow so the surfers must be talented, and not to mention, they have quite an audience watching them there every day so only the most confident try it out.

Dallmayr: Munich’s Luxury Food Hall

A family owned business with some of the most famous coffee in all of Europe, Dallmayr has every delicious specialty food you could want–from fresh produce, fish, meats, homemade breads and the sweets—oh the sweets! I took home a box of their sugary fruit gelees as well as their local honeys. But trust me, I could eat all my meals at Dallmary everyday. This is how food markets should be.

Munich’s Best Beergarden

In my opinion, Munich’s Best Beer Garden is the Wirsthaus at BavariaPark, and believe me, that is high praise. Munich is home to some of the best beer gardens, large & small, indoors & out. This one really struck me because of it’s laid back “locals-only” atmosphere, naturally beautiful landscape, very good food and of course, Munich’s favorite Augustiner beer on tap. It’s also just steps away from the Oktoberfest fairgrounds.

They also have the upscale Kongresshalle bar next door, perfect for the transition from a few steins and food by day, to a classy cocktail & dancing by night. Put this on your itinerary for Munich and plan to stay a while. 🙂
